Three nursing students injured as college bus overturns

Last Updated 01 February 2017, 21:05 IST

 Three students of a nursing college were injured and 15 had a miraculous escape when their bus hit a median and turned turtle.

The incident occurred on Chord Road on Wednesday morning. Students, all boys of Bhavani Nursing College in KP Agrahara, were returning to their hostel from KSR-Bengaluru City Railway Station after a trip to Gujarat.

According to the police, the accident occurred at around 5.30 am when the driver was trying to avoid collision with another vehicle on a slope at the Chord Road-Magadi Road junction.

The driver lost control over the bus and hit the median. The impact was so severe that the bus turned turtle.

The three injured students were shifted to a nearby hospital where they are undergoing treatment.

A few others were given first aid and discharged as outpatients. As it was early in the morning, traffic was thin, but passersby rushed to the help of the students. Kamakshipalya traffic police cleared the road by towing away the bus.

No complaint

 “We have not received a complaint from anyone regarding this incident. No other vehicle was involved. We helped in clearing the road and traffic resumed,” a senior police officer said.
